Jim Kelly Biography

Brief Introduction of Jim Kelly

James Edward “Jim” Kelly is a retired American football quarterback who is widely regarded as one of the greatest players in National Football League (NFL) history. He spent the entirety of his remarkable 11-season NFL career with the Buffalo Bills, leading the team to an unprecedented four consecutive Super Bowl appearances from 1991 to 1994. Known for his “linebacker’s mentality” and masterful execution of the “K-Gun” no-huddle offense, Kelly became the face of the Bills franchise and a symbol of resilience and toughness, both on and off the field. His exceptional leadership, powerful arm, and unwavering determination earned him a first-ballot induction into the Pro Football Hall of Fame in 2002. Beyond his football career, Jim Kelly is known for his courageous public battles with cancer and his tireless philanthropic work through the Hunter’s Hope Foundation, an organization he and his wife founded in honor of their late son.

Early Life and Education of Jim Kelly

Jim Kelly was born on February 14, 1960, in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ania, and grew up in the small town of East Brady. From a young age, Kelly displayed exceptional athletic ability. At East Brady High School, he was a standout in both football and basketball. As the quarterback, he amassed an impressive 3,915 passing yards and 44 touchdowns, earning all-state honors. On the basketball court, he was equally dominant, scoring over 1,000 points and averaging 23 points and 20 rebounds during his senior year. His athletic prowess attracted the attention of major college football programs. Penn State University, under the legendary coach Joe Paterno, recruited Kelly to play linebacker. However, Kelly was determined to be a quarterback and ultimately accepted a scholarship from the University of Miami, where he was promised the opportunity to play his desired position.

At the University of Miami, Kelly became a pivotal player in the transformation of the Hurricanes’ football program into a national powerhouse. He showcased his strong arm and leadership skills, setting school records for pass completions, passing yards, and touchdown passes. In 1981, he led the Hurricanes to a victory in the Peach Bowl, where he was named the offensive MVP. His stellar collegiate career concluded with 5,228 passing yards and 33 touchdowns. In recognition of his contributions, he was inducted into the University of Miami Sports Hall of Fame in 1992.

Jim Kelly’s Career

Jim Kelly’s professional career began with the historic 1983 NFL Draft, which featured a remarkable class of quarterbacks. The Buffalo Bills selected Kelly with the 14th overall pick. However, Kelly was hesitant to play in Buffalo’s cold climate and instead opted to sign with the Houston Gamblers of the newly formed United States Football League (USFL). In the USFL, Kelly quickly became a star, thriving in the run-and-shoot offense. In his two seasons with the Gamblers, he threw for an astounding 9,842 yards and 83 touchdowns. He was named the USFL MVP in 1984 after a season in which he threw for 5,219 yards and 44 touchdowns.

When the USFL folded in 1986, Kelly’s NFL rights were still held by the Buffalo Bills. He finally joined the team for the 1986 season and embarked on a career that would redefine the franchise. Kelly was the centerpiece of the Bills’ high-powered “K-Gun” offense, a fast-paced, no-huddle attack that terrorized opposing defenses throughout the early 1990s. With Hall of Fame teammates Thurman Thomas at running back and Andre Reed at wide receiver, Kelly led the Bills to an era of unprecedented success. From 1990 to 1993, he guided the Bills to a record four consecutive Super Bowl appearances, a feat that remains unmatched in NFL history. Although the Bills were unable to secure a victory in any of those championship games, Kelly’s leadership and performance during that period were widely praised.

Throughout his 11 seasons with the Bills, Kelly was selected to the Pro Bowl five times and was a first-team All-Pro in 1991. He holds numerous Bills franchise records, including career passing yards (35,467), touchdown passes (237), and completions (2,874). At the time of his retirement after the 1996 season, his 84.4 passer rating was among the highest in NFL history. In 2001, his number 12 jersey was retired by the Buffalo Bills, and in 2002, he was inducted into the Pro Football Hall of Fame in his first year of eligibility.

Jim Kelly Personal Life & Family

Jim Kelly’s personal life has been marked by both immense joy and profound challenges. He is married to Jill Kelly, and together they have three children: two daughters, Erin and Camryn, and a son, Hunter. Hunter was born on February 14, 1997, sharing a birthday with his father. Shortly after his birth, Hunter was diagnosed with Krabbe disease, a rare and fatal genetic disorder that affects the nervous system. Doctors gave him a grim prognosis, but Hunter bravely fought the disease for over eight years before his passing on August 5, 2005, at the age of 8. Hunter’s life had a profound impact on the Kelly family and inspired them to establish the Hunter’s Hope Foundation to raise awareness and funds for Krabbe disease research.

In addition to the heartbreak of losing his son, Jim Kelly has faced his own serious health battles. In 2013, he was diagnosed with squamous cell carcinoma, a form of cancer in his upper jaw. He has since undergone multiple surgeries and treatments to combat the disease, which has recurred several times. Throughout his health struggles, Kelly has maintained a positive and resilient attitude, drawing strength from his faith, family, and the support of his fans. His public fight with cancer has served as an inspiration to many. He has spoken openly about his experiences, encouraging others to persevere in the face of adversity.

Jim Kelly Net Worth and Income

As of 2025, Jim Kelly’s net worth is estimated to be between $20 million and $25 million. The foundation of his wealth was built during his successful career in the USFL and the NFL. His initial contract with the Houston Gamblers was substantial for its time, and upon joining the Buffalo Bills, he became one of the highest-paid players in the NFL. Over his 11 seasons with the Bills, his career earnings from salary and bonuses were significant. Following his retirement from football, Kelly has remained active in various business ventures. He is a sought-after motivational speaker and has participated in numerous corporate events. He also runs the annual Jim Kelly Football Camp, which has been in operation for many years. Additionally, he has had endorsement deals and other business interests that contribute to his income.

Legacy and Influence

Jim Kelly’s legacy extends far beyond his impressive statistics and Hall of Fame induction. He is remembered as one of the toughest and most resilient quarterbacks to ever play the game. His leadership of the Buffalo Bills during their Super Bowl era solidified his place as a franchise icon and a beloved figure in Western New York. The “K-Gun” offense, which he orchestrated with precision, is still regarded as one of the most exciting and effective offensive schemes in NFL history. Off the field, Kelly’s impact is equally profound. His public battles with cancer and the tragic loss of his son have revealed a man of immense courage and character. Through the Hunter’s Hope Foundation, he has turned personal tragedy into a force for good, raising millions of dollars for research and providing support to families affected by Krabbe disease. His unwavering spirit in the face of adversity has made him an inspirational figure to millions.
